This event is the fifth in a series of continuing education days for certified casting instructors.
The first Continuing Education program presented will be a Direct Instruction Workshop, The Anatomy of Loop Dynamics: Teaching Loop Control (By David Diaz, MCI/BOG) - With a theory of loop dynamics, instructors can teach students how to control loop formation, an essential instructor’s skill.
Students frequently can cast and fish, do both well, but remain naïve about casting theory. Some will stay uninformed forever. Under- standing loop dynamics is necessary for fault diagnosis and remedy. Teaching students how to control the formation of the loop is essential skill for instructors. For that skill an understanding of loop dynamics, what conditions of line, rod, and hand movement result in the loop is a required for certified instructors. Without a useable theory of loop dynamics, the casting instructor is compromised.
The second program will be Eric Cook’s Beyond the Checkbox seminar - Testing is as much an obligation for casting instructors as teaching. The path to becoming a good examiner extends beyond evaluating casting skills. The MCI test is less structured than the CI test. It has social constraints.Examiners have to be adaptable not just willing to follow a script in response to candidate responses.
A third program, Secrets of the Invisible Pulley by Mac Brown - Archimedes understood fly casting. Refining one’s understanding of casting to realize that we direct fly lines with energy is a momentous step toward capturing the actual big picture. Rods and hands are our mechanisms.
